A method is disclosed for the production of tissue factor pathway inhibitor (TFPI) which comprises expression of a non-glycosylated form of TFPI in E. coli as host and obtaining a highly active TFPI by in vitro refolding of the protein in which inclusion bodies isolated from the E. coli cells are subjected to stepwise purification comprising either series (A) or series (B) as follows:n (A)n (1) subjecting the inclusion bodies to sulfitolysis to form TFPI-S-sulfonate, (2) purifying TFPI-S-sulfonate by anion exchange chromatography, (3) refolding TFPI-S-sulfonate by disulfide interchange reaction, and (4) purifying active refolded TFPI by cation exchange chromatography, or (B)n (1) subjecting the inclusion bodies to reduction with ß-mercaptoethanol in urea to form reduced TFPI, (2) purifying the reduced TFPI by cation exchange chromatography, (3) refolding reduced TFPI by disulfide interchange reaction in urea, and (4) purifying the active refolded TFPI by cation exchange chromatography. |
